Andrew Murray Vineyards
Andrew Murray—a grape-growing pioneer and Rhône varietal visionary in Santa Barbara County—founded his winery in 1990, planting a hillside vineyard dedicated exclusively to Rhône varieties. Murray and his team look forward to sharing the AMV experience at their newly remodeled winery and visitor center along Foxen Canyon Road. Lafond Winery & Vineyards
5
TASTING AT THE VINE YARD
Long known as Santa Barbara’s tastemaker, Pierre Lafond founded Santa Barbara County’s first winery since prohibition (now located in downtown Santa Barbara, two blocks from the beach). His 65 acres in the Sta. Rita Hills and 30 acres across the river have produced medal-awarded syrah, chardonnay, and a pinot noir that “is truly an expression” of the Sta. Rita Hills appellation.
